
Instant Miso Soup
Instant miso soup is a dehydrated form of the traditional Japanese fermented soybean soup, packaged for quick preparation. This convenience product typically combines powdered miso paste with dried seaweed, tofu, and green onions, requiring only hot water to reconstitute. While offering the characteristic umami-rich flavor of traditional miso soup, the instant version generally contains higher sodium levels and fewer live probiotics due to the processing methods used in manufacturing.
Macro Impact
A 1 packet serving contains 63 calories, 4g protein, 9g carbs, and 1g fat.
